Graduate Certificate in Ethnic Counseling Techniques
-- ViewingNowThe Graduate Certificate in Ethnic Counseling Techniques is a vital course designed to equip learners with the necessary skills to work effectively with diverse ethnic populations. This program emphasizes the importance of cultural competence in counseling, addressing the unique needs and challenges faced by various ethnic groups.

CourseDetails
- Understanding Cultural Diversity & Identity
- Historical Trauma & Its Impact on Ethnic Groups
- Culturally Sensitive Assessment & Diagnosis
- Ethnic Counseling Theories & Techniques
- Multicultural Counseling Competencies
- Social Justice & Advocacy in Ethnic Counseling
- Culturally Responsive Intervention Strategies
- Research Methods in Ethnic Counseling
- Supervised Field Experience in Ethnic Counseling
